Subject: 27.0.50; highlighted region remains highlighted after command
Date: Tue, 28 Jan 2020 16:37:58 +0100
[Message part 1 (text/plain, inline)]
I am in octave-mode running an inferior octave shell. Now I mark a region
and issue 'octave-send-region'. As expected, all commands are executed and
echoed in the shell buffer, and highlighting is finally cleared.

After a couple of more region-sending, however, it stops to work: The
corresponding commands are still executed, but the *highlighting fails to
clear* (it can be cleared using Ctrl-g).

I see this behavior now for at least a couple of years, before that it was
ok.
BTW, in shell-mode and matlab-mode the corresponding region is never
cleared after sending.
